Education #YouAsked How many public and independent schools does South Africa have? Source Department of Basic Education: School Realities 2024 Short answer How many public and independent schools does South Africa have? According to the Department of Basic Education, South Africa had 24,850 schools in 2024. Of these, 22,381 were public schools and 2,469 were independent. Public schools receive government funding, while independent schools are privately run but registered with provincial education departments.... Back Full answer

#YouAsked Natural resources & energy Which African countries generate the most electricity from nuclear power? Source World Nuclear Association: Nuclear Generation by Country Short answer Which African countries generate the most electricity from nuclear power? South Africa is the only African country generating electricity from nuclear power. It produced 8.2 billion kWh (4.4% of its grid) in 2023, according to the World Nuclear Association. #YouAsked Health Is it true that South Africans drink more alcohol than any other African country? Source WHO:Total alcohol consumption per capita (litres of pure alcohol, projected estimates, 15+ years of age) Short answer Is it true that South Africans drink more alcohol than any other African country? The per capita consumption of alcohol in South Africa was 8.8 litres in 2019, according to the World Health Organization. This was higher than the global average of 5.4 litres Sub-Saharan Africa average of 4.5 litres. ... Back Full answer
